Output 405055fa7da76c9adabde4c51118bc101443e4925f6e9529bb35dac5761d405a:1

value
26124196
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e68b546f04b3afadc3df80c2398ab9b525e84cd6 OP_EQUALVERIFY OP_CHECKSIG
address
LgExb93hZW8bqvMvoaEe8cmAHPKj1Pz79A
transaction
405055fa7da76c9adabde4c51118bc101443e4925f6e9529bb35dac5761d405a
spent
true